What this notice means

Liquidation winds a company up: a licensed insolvency practitioner (the liquidator) is appointed to sell the company's assets and distribute the proceeds to creditors in the order fixed by law, after which the company is dissolved. A creditors' voluntary liquidation (CVL) is started by the company's own directors and shareholders once it can no longer pay its debts as they fall due.

ZENITH PIVOTAL LTD owes me money — what can I do?

If ZENITH PIVOTAL LTD owes you money you are a creditor in the process. The insolvency practitioner named in the notice will write to known creditors and invite claims. Unsecured creditors rank after fixed-charge holders, the costs of the insolvency, preferential creditors and floating-charge holders, so recovery depends on what is left in the estate.

I worked for ZENITH PIVOTAL LTD — how do I claim what I am owed?

Unpaid wages, holiday pay and statutory redundancy are claimed from the government's Redundancy Payments Service, not from the company or from K2. The insolvency practitioner named in this notice should give you a case reference to claim with.
